The gut-skin connection is grounded in the understanding that a healthy gut can lead to healthier skin. The gut microbiome, which consists of trillions of bacteria and microorganisms, plays a crucial role in various bodily functions, including digestion, metabolism, and immune response. Recent research suggests that imbalances in gut bacteria can contribute to skin issues like inflammation, acne, and even accelerated aging. Consequently, improving gut health may result in more radiant and youthful skin.
Probiotics, the beneficial bacteria found in fermented foods and supplements, are known for their positive effects on gut health. When consumed, they can help restore balance to the gut microbiome, potentially alleviating digestive issues and enhancing overall well-being. There is growing evidence to suggest that probiotics may also benefit the skin by reducing inflammation, regulating sebum production, and enhancing hydration. Some studies even indicate that certain strains of probiotics might help minimize the visible signs of aging, including fine lines and wrinkles.
When it comes to gut-skin probiotic formulas, the concept is straightforward: these supplements are designed to support gut health while also providing specific benefits to the skin. Many of these products contain a blend of various probiotic strains, prebiotics, and other vitamins or minerals known to promote skin elasticity and hydration. Some manufacturers even tout additional ingredients such as collagen or antioxidants, which are also linked to skin health.
Before you jump on the gut-skin probiotics bandwagon, it’s essential to consider a few factors. Firstly, not all probiotic supplements are created equal. The effectiveness of a formula can depend on the strains used, their viability, and the dosage. Therefore, it’s crucial to research and choose a reputable product that has been backed by clinical studies.
Additionally, the results may not be instant. Just like other skincare treatments, it can take time to see visible improvements. While you might notice subtle changes within a few weeks, significant enhancements in skin texture or wrinkle reduction could take several months of consistent use. Patience and commitment are key when using any new skincare regimen, including probiotics.
It’s also worth noting that while gut-skin probiotic formulas can offer benefits, they should not be seen as a miracle cure for wrinkles. A comprehensive approach to skincare is essential. This includes a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and healthy fats, regular exercise, good hydration, ample sleep, and, importantly, a consistent skincare routine tailored to your skin type.
Furthermore, if you have specific skin concerns or conditions, it’s advisable to consult with a dermatologist or healthcare professional before starting any new supplement. They can provide personalized recommendations and ensure that the supplements won’t interfere with any medications or existing treatments.
